SkillAgentSearch skills...

Raphael.serialize

RaphaelJS Plugin to serialize SVG Objects for exporting

Install / Use

/learn @jspies/Raphael.serialize
About this skill

Quality Score

0/100

Supported Platforms

Universal

README

=Raphael.serialize

This is a plugin to http://raphaeljs.com, a javascript library for working with SVG on the web. This plugin gives functions for saving SVG data and loading it back into the canvas.

Currently supports JSON and basic shapes.

==Install

Just include the raphael.serialize.js after you include the raphael.js library.

==Usage

The plugin extends the RaphaelJS object.

var paper = Raphael('yourcanvas', '300', '300'); // Do some drawing var json = paper.serialize.json(); // saves as json paper.clear(); paper.serialize.load_json(json); // load it back

Thanks to Ben Barnett http://www.benbarnett.net/ for his work on serializing paths.

Related Skills

View on GitHub
GitHub Stars120
CategoryDevelopment
Updated1mo ago
Forks19

Languages

JavaScript

Security Score

80/100

Audited on Feb 20, 2026

No findings